A position statement is like a thesis or goal. It describes one side of an arguable viewpoint. To write a position statement, gather a list of reasons to support a particular viewpoint. Next, write a sentence or two that pulls all the information together and makes your stand clear to the audience.

Template 1: For [target market] [brand name] is a [category] that offers [point of difference] so customers can make [key benefit] because [reason to believe]. Template 2: For [target market] who [target market needs], [brand name] provides [key benefit].
